The Free On-line Dictionary of Computing (30 December 2018):
exclamation mark
!
excl
exclamation point
shriek
    The character "!" with ASCII code 33.
   Common names: bang; pling; excl (/eks'kl/); shriek; ITU-T:
   exclamation mark, exclamation point (US).  Rare: factorial;
   exclam; smash; cuss; boing; yell; wow; hey; wham; eureka;
   soldier; INTERCAL: spark-spot.
   The Commonwealth Hackish, "pling", is common among Acorn
   Archimedes owners.  Bang is more common in the USA.
   The occasional CMU usage, "shriek", is also used by APL
   fans and mathematicians, especially category theorists.
   Exclamation mark is used in C and elsewhere as the logical
   negation operation (NOT).
